Google Play Store Apps That Stole Bank Credentials Were Downloaded 300,000 Times

Over 300,000 downloads from the Google Play store have been attributed to malicious Android apps that pilfered sensitive financial data, as per a report from ThreatFabric researchers. The apps, camouflaged as QR scanners, PDF scanners, or cryptocurrency wallets, surreptitiously harvested user banking details, passwords, two-factor authentication codes, and keystrokes. Karnataka Chief Minister Launches Mobile App For Direct Transfer Of Funds

BS Yediyurappa, the Chief Minister of Karnataka, inaugurated a mobile application for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) today, facilitating the direct transfer of funds to beneficiaries enrolled in various government welfare schemes.
